Description

A lovely 2-bedroom end-terrace house, tucked away down a private track with field views, whilst conveniently situated on the Kings Lynn - Spalding bus route and just a mile from the amenities of Long Sutton.

Downstairs, the property comprises of a spacious living room with a decorative fireplace and a door out onto the front garden, a bright and airy kitchen with fitted units, space for dining and access to the side garden too.

Upstairs, off the landing is a large king-size bedroom with a built-in storage cupboard, a second good-sized single bedroom, utilised by the current owner as a home office, and a family bathroom with a shower over the bath.

Externally, to the front of the property is a fully-enclosed lawned garden with a large summer house, ideal for relaxing or even use as a playhouse, whilst to the side of the property is a further lawned garden with borders and a patio over which an electric blind extends; an ideal spot to position outdoor furniture on which to relax and enjoy the field views. The side garden benefits from two metal storage sheds. To the rear of the property is off-road parking for 2 vehicles.

The small but busy Market Town of Long Sutton has a good range of amenities including Co-Op Store/Post Office, Tesco One Stop, Boots Pharmacy, Health Centre, Library, Ironmongers, Electrical store, Dentists, Hairdressers and various eateries. The larger towns of Kings Lynn and Spalding are both approximately 13 miles away and have ongoing coach and rail links direct to London and the North. The North Norfolk coast is just a 45-minute drive. The smaller nearby Town of Sutton Bridge also offers a challenging Golf Course along with the Sir Peter Scott Walk.
